Application
<ul>
<li><strong>Oxalic Acid Dihydrate in Nanomaterial Synthesis:</strong> During the co-precursor driven solid-state thermal reactions oxalic acid dihydrate is used to produce hematite nanomaterials, providing insights into its role in enhancing reaction kinetics for material science applications (Chakraborty et al., 2023).</li>
<li><strong>Oxalic Acid Dihydrate in Polymer Research:</strong>oxalic acid dihydrate is used in modifying the supramolecular structure of bamboo to facilitate the production of lignin-containing nanocellulose, highlighting its utility in sustainable material processing (Wang et al., 2023).</li>
